SECTION 7-1.2-1323
§ 7-1.2-1323 Jurisdiction of court to
appoint a receiver.
Upon the establishment of any of the grounds for liquidation of the assets and
business of
(1) A domestic corporation or
(2) A foreign corporation, to the extent the foreign
corporation has assets within the state, stated in § 7-1.2-1314, and upon
the establishment that the liquidation would not be appropriate, the superior
court has full power to appoint a receiver, with any powers and duties that the
court, from time to time, directs, and to take any other proceedings that the
court deems advisable under the circumstances. The provisions of §§
7-1.2-1314 7-1.2-1322, insofar as they are consistent with the nature of
the proceeding, apply to the proceeding, and in the proceeding the court has
the full powers of a court of equity to make or enter any orders, injunctions,
and decrees and grant any other relief in the proceeding that justice and
equity require.
History of Section.
(P.L. 2004, ch. 216, § 2; P.L. 2004, ch. 274, § 2.)
